Output d5877ca981fb1b4a94f9c7be9312d265974a228fe5dec38a24d9f7d575c49a98:10

value
13989508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d11d640f6f8595f277d5b27f64be8d8cd5cd92c OP_EQUALVERIFY OP_CHECKSIG
address
16Zub2vfd9GwJAZNnFriB1oGz219V2H5Z6
transaction
d5877ca981fb1b4a94f9c7be9312d265974a228fe5dec38a24d9f7d575c49a98
spent
true